Latvian ATP players in the news
Deniss Pavlovs is the second seed in the Bosnia Herzegovina F2 in Sarajevo. He will face either Aleksander Slovic or Juan-Miguel Such-Perez in the second round of singles. He is also partnering Goran Tosic in the doubles. They are seeded third and defeated Robert Belak/Luka Belic in the first round.
Karlis Lejnieks is the third seed in the Heraklio F2 in Greece. The tournament is played on artificial grass. He defeated Germany's Soren Goritzka in the first round, and will face Paris Gemouchidis next.
